: If a game isn't found, you can manually select the game's executable ( .exe ) by browsing your local files. For Steam users, this is typically found by right-clicking the game in your library, selecting Manage , and then Browse local files .
While Frosty is the gold standard for Frostbite modding, some communities have developed specific alternatives. For instance, the client for Star Wars: Battlefront II is designed as a complete replacement for online and offline modding.
